Diskussion zum Artikel "Leitfaden zum Testen und Optimieren von Expert Advisors in MQL5"

 

Neuer Artikel Leitfaden zum Testen und Optimieren von Expert Advisors in MQL5 :

Dieser Beitrag erklärt den schrittweisen Vorgang zur Identifizierung und Lösung von Fehlern im Code sowie alle Schritte für das Testen und die Optimierung der Expert Advisor Eingabeparameter. Sie lernen hier, wie Sie den Strategie-Tester des MetaTrader 5 Client-Terminals verwenden, um das beste Symbol und Set an Eingabeparameter für Ihren Expert Advisor zu finden.

Abb. 38 Analyse des vorläufigen Optimierungsergebnisses

Autor: Samuel Olowoyo

 

Es wird kategorisch davon abgeraten, Remote-Agenten im selben Verzeichnis hinzuzufügen.

Vor allem nicht, um die Leute zu verwirren und ihnen zu empfehlen, ernsthafte Probleme zu schaffen, nur um eine 2-Sekunden-Beschleunigung bei den nachfolgenden Auto-Updates des Systems zu erreichen. Wir haben das Problem des Geschwindigkeitsunterschieds zwischen einem einzelnen Startup und einem entfernten Agenten bereits praktisch gelöst, es wird in den nächsten Builds verfügbar sein.


Ich empfehle, den Block über entfernte Agenten komplett aus dem Artikel zu entfernen.
 

Diese Frage wurde im Hauptforum(https://www.mql5.com/en/forum/2584) neu gestellt.

Vielen Dank für die Erstellung dieses Artikels, aber gibt es eine Möglichkeit, auf die Funktionen des genetischen Optimierers von Metatrader zuzugreifen, ohne die Optimierung manuell vom Backtesting-Terminal aus durchführen zu müssen?

Was ich suche, ist eine Möglichkeit, einen EA on the fly mit mql zu optimieren. Es wurde erwähnt, dass dies mit Matlab Interaktion zu tun, aber ich bin nicht so vertraut mit Matlab und daher wäre dies ziemlich schwierig. Jede Hilfe/Empfehlungen mit on the fly Optimierung würde sehr geschätzt werden. Danke.

Optimizing on the fly and backtesting
  • www.mql5.com
Currently I'm developing EAs and backtesting them using MT5 with a metaquotes demo account, but I'm not sure how accurate the backtesting tick data is.
 

Hallo!

Können Sie mir sagen, was die roten Linien bedeuten, die während der Optimierung in der Tabelle auf der Registerkarte"Optimierungsergebnisse" erscheinen?

 
Ich würde gerne wissen, wie ist die Qualität der Modellierung? Ist besser als der MT4? Herunterladen von historischen Daten, bekomme ich zu einem 99% Modellierung in MT4 haben.
Und in MT5, wie funktioniert es? Es ist 100% die Qualität der Modellierung?
 
Ein ausgezeichneter Artikel für mql5-Programmieranfänger. Vielen Dank Samuel
 
Können Sie mir bitte sagen, ob es einen ähnlichen Artikel über das Testen und Optimieren von Expert Advisors für MQL 4 gibt. Ich kann nicht finden, zumindest Referenz Bücher von Fehlercodes, Beispiele für häufige Fehler, muss ich für eine Beschreibung der einzelnen Fehler durch eine Suche im Internet zu suchen.
 
Ausgezeichneter Artikel, Samuel. Er hat mir wirklich geholfen, meine Zweifel bezüglich der Optimierung meiner AE zu klären. Vielen Dank für Ihre Bereitschaft zu helfen und aufzuklären.
 
fenix74:
Können Sie mir bitte sagen, ob es einen ähnlichen Artikel über das Testen und Optimieren von Expert Advisors für MQL 4 gibt.
Haben Sie sich die Artikel angesehen? https://www.mql5.com/de/articles/mt4/strategy_tester
Статьи по MQL4: Тестер
Статьи по MQL4: Тестер
  • www.mql5.com
Статьи по программированию на языке MQL4
 

Ich verstehe immer noch nicht, was "pass" bedeutet.

Was bedeutet das?

Bedeutet es, dass ein höherer Wert besser ist?

Ich kann im Handbuch keine Anleitung dazu finden, zumindest ist nicht klar, was es wirklich bedeutet.